Hi All,
We have activated the Servicenow for Microsoft 365 integration for our client in Dev. The Employee Center is visible and working as expected. But when we click on the Chat tab we just get a general message and nothing else works. How do we make the Chat feature work? Please refer screenshot.
Any help on the matter is appreciated.

I think this response usually indicates that the necessary Virtual Agent Teams integration isn’t fully configured, even if the Employee Center tab works...
ServiceNow Virtual Agent in Microsoft Teams requires a proper integration setup, not just the plugin installation. You must also integrate the Virtual Agent via the manifest setup. This step enables the chat function to function properly.
Install the Conversational Integration with Microsoft Teams App from the ServiceNow Store and install the Conversational Integration with Microsoft Teams app. Configure the Integration and Update the Teams App Manifest in channels
